At 10 bits per key we expect roughly
// a 1% false-positive rate, which keeps read amplification acceptable under
// the current cache-miss budget. Raising this value enlarges the filter's
// memory footprint linearly, so release builds must be re-profiled before
// shipping any change. This constant is baked into the on-disk format, so
// it is release-gated. Verify the change against the build token recorded
// directly below this comment.

trace token, kawip-fafog: htk14_26e64c4d35154e

## Service Accounts — QuickType Index

The autocomplete index (QuickType) has been slow since the Brindlewood migration. Rebuilds run under the svc-quicktype account, owned by the Findery platform team. Do not reuse this account for ad hoc queries. Rebuild jobs hit the internal IndexForge API; throttle to 50 req/s or the index lags further. Authenticate rebuild calls with the key below.

gateway credential: kto3_qfe

## Releases

The Vantrell audit-log viewer follows a two-week release cadence. Each release is cut from the stable branch, tagged, and built in the Corvid pipeline, which produces a checksummed archive and a changelog. As a contractor you won't cut releases yourself at first, but you should understand verification: every archive is signed before publication, and downstream installers reject unsigned builds. The signing key currently used for release artifacts appears below.

deploy key for kajof-fajop: bky6_gDHw9Q

Team — DR drill for the Liftwise elevator-dispatch simulator runs Thursday, 0900. We'll kill the primary sim cluster and verify failover to the Marrow Hill standby. On-call: confirm dispatch replay resumes within five minutes and car-assignment latency stays under 200ms. No customer impact expected; sims only. If the standby console rejects your login during the drill, use the recovery passphrase directly below.

recovery phrase for bawep-kawef: oliath-casdor

Handover — LaundryLift locker access flow. Tarek, picking up from Mira. PIN-entry path is stable; NFC fallback still flaky on the Kestrel v2 panels at the Brampton pilot site. Retry logic merged, feature-flagged off. Release manager: flag stays off until panel firmware 3.4 ships. To unlock the staging admin vault for smoke tests, use the recovery passphrase below.

unlock words, yawig-kagef: gordor-holvan-ulaael-pramir-ulaiel-tamdor